Does this package have Python crc_hqx function equivalent?

I am trying to convert Python library to dart and I am not sure what the equivalent function for crc_hqx in this dependency.

Example from python

binary_packet = 'fef052000232a1000000000034000100000000000000000013bb2e6100000000000000000000f0fe1c00000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000'
or
binary_packet = [254, 240, 82, 0, 2, 50, 161,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 52, 0, 1,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 168, 187, 46, 97,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 240, 254, 28,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0]

result = crc_hqx(binary_packet, 0x1021);
// result will be 56902

Getting incremental CRC value

Hello,

I'm sure this could also be a stack overflow question with this library linked, but I wanted to reach out directly in case this needs to be a potential "enhancement".

So, I'd like to be able to convert chunks of data where, at each update of the sink, I have access to the current CRC value so that I can use that. So far I see startChunkedConversion(), addSlice(), and other functions that seem to be useful for what I need to accomplish, but no way to get intermediary crc value along the way, only getting a final CRC value.

Is there a way to do this currently? Would this need to be added?
